ALIGHT Horn of Africa is an entrepreneurial humanitarian and development organization that assists displaced people to move from vulnerability to resilience, from impoverishment to a basic level of well-being, and from exclusion to inclusion. a
The overall objective of ALIGHT Horn of Africa’s Somalia/Somaliland program is to broaden opportunities for disadvantaged communities in (particularly women and youth) to pursue a secure and sustainable livelihood; create an environment that enables social and economic re-integration of Somali youth into society through technical, vocational and leadership skills development that enables young people to secure gainful employment; sustainably rehabilitate through social transformation and economic empowerment; respond to recurring emergencies and help build resiliency of communities through strengthening of existing social services such as health and water facilities/structures and support creation of durable solutions for returnees to Somalia through a set of integrated activities aimed at socio-economic reintegration into their country and communities of origin.
ALIGHT Horn of Africa has its Area office – Mogaidsu, Jubaland in Kismayo and field offices in Dhobley, Afmadow and Representatives in Warsheekh and Balcad of Hirshabeele and Southwest. ALIGHT Horn of Africa implements an extensive drought response and lifesaving programs focusing on Health, WASH, Shelter, Livelihoods and protection. ALIGHT Horn of Africa also implements resilience and recovery programs, and aim to engage and expand its arm to the private sector, youth environment and resilience building.
